Birth Defect Law

Birth injuries and birth defects can result from a variety of causes. In many instances, these issues are preventable.

Often, they are caused by medical malpractice during pregnancy. Other causes include chemical exposure. Beauty salon employees and paint factories and metal cleaning operations, are at a higher risk of developing these types of defects.

Causes

Birth defects are structural abnormalities that can affect one or more body parts. They can vary in severity, ranging from mild to life-threatening. Approximately 1 out of 33 babies are born with a birth defect every year.

If a baby is born with a birth defect it can be devastating for parents and their family members. Certain birth defects are passed down through the genes of a parent, while others can be caused by a number of factors, such as problems with obstetrics and pregnancy, side-effects of medications as well as toxins and infections.

Birth defect lawyers and studies have proven that some of birth defects are due to environmental factors, such as medication that is not properly prescribed by doctors and toxic chemicals at home and workplace, and toxic substances that can contaminate the environment. In the Vietnam War, mothers were exposed to the herbicide Agent Orange, which resulted in birth defects in children. Sadly, a lot of these birth defects could be prevented by the proper care.

Symptoms

Birth defects can alter the way your body appears and performs. It could be a structural issue like a lip or palate cleft or it could be caused by genetic changes. A chromosome is responsible for Down syndrome. Certain medications and environmental factors could contribute to the condition.

Some birth defects are extremely evident, such as mouths or lips that have clefts some are less obvious. They may be caused by a slow response to sound, or the inability to reach milestones in development, like climbing up and sitting.

Birth injuries can be caused by an abnormality in the birth or it could happen during the labor and delivery process like the caput succedaneum (a swelling on a newborn's scalp due to pressure during a head-first delivery). Sometimes, these injuries can be difficult to discern, particularly when they manifest as lowered heart rate, poor oxygen levels, or the drooling.
